This weekend our team attended the Administer Justice Conference, centered on the theme of Breaking Down Barriers. We were inspired by Bruce Strom and other speakers, and encouraged by connecting with attorneys, volunteers, and Justice Center teams committed to bringing hope and justice to vulnerable people.
Administer Justice is a faith-based legal aid ministry providing free legal help, hope, and dignity to those in need. Our team returned encouraged and equipped with new ideas to better serve our community.
A few statistics shared at the conference were especially impactful:
- 150 million civil legal matters arise each year
- 1 in 3 people cannot afford a lawyer
- 46 million Americans are turned away from legal help annually
- 40% of U.S. counties have little or no access to a lawyer
- 92% of legal issues facing low-income Americans are not fully addressed
These aren’t just numbers; they represent people facing real challenges without guidance or support.
